In 2020-2021, 687 people earned their degree in agricultural mechanics and equipment/machine technology, making the major the 679th most popular in the United States.

Across the Middle Atlantic region, there were 5 agricultural mechanics and equipment/machine technology gra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the associate degree level specifically, there were 5 agricultural mechanics and equipment/machine technology graduates with average earnings and debt of $35,164 and $17,633 respectively.
